My computer has run into the problem were when I run a heavy games like call of duty or god of war, the screen will instantly go to black and the fans on my gpu will start spinning at high rmps, but the computer itself is still on (gpu rgb and motherboard light is on) and I turn it back on by pressing the restart button on the case. Games like overwatch run fine and don’t cause the issue to happen. The problem also happens when I’m not even playing games, it will just randomly happen while I’m doing something. I’ve tried multiple solutions online, which non have worked so I’m going here for help. Somebody told me to repair windows in the cmd and it worked for like 4 hours but then the problem came back. I’ve also heard that other people have been having this problem recently and that it’s a new issue that has been coming up for people. The pc is virtually unusable so It would be great if someone could help me. Intel i5 9400F 2.9GHz 6-core CPU Gigabyte B365M DS3H Micro ATX Mother board Adata XPG Z1 (2x8gb) 3000mhz ram Kingston A400 240gb SSD EVGA GeForce RTX 2080 GPU CoolerMaster Masterbox TD500 Thermaltake Smart Pro RGB 850w 80+ Bronze PSU Windows 10, 64 bit

Tools like HWMonitor, OpenHardwareMonitor, and HWInfo64 Stress Test (OCCT, prime95, FurMark, MSI Kombustor) are available. 3. I meant dust and similar issues. 4. You can't modify the BIOS via Device Manager; drivers might help, but BIOS updates aren't possible there. Follow the manufacturer's instructions—links to the BIOS page are provided. You can verify your BIOS version using tools such as CPU-Z, Aida64, or Speccy. 5. Please proceed accordingly.
